Description:

The Manager, Allied Health Community is a key leadership role in the Allied Health Community portfolio and reports directly to the Director, Allied Health Community.

This position is responsible and accountable for providing the direction, leadership and organization of programs and operations within the Allied Health Community portfolio in support of the vision, mission, and business plan of Alberta Health Services.

The position is also responsible and accountable for making operational decisions and having direct leadership responsibility for implementing activities that contribute to the achievement of the goals of the Community Health Services division from a staffing and service delivery perspective.

The Manager, Allied Health Community develops and maintains strong working relationships with key stakeholders in order to provide leadership.

Extensive partnerships internal and external to the organization, including acute care, tertiary care, continuing care, SCNs, PCNs, and other community partners as well as professional colleges and post-secondary institutions, are critical in Allied Health program development and management and in the provision of seamless, high quality and sustainable patient care.

The Manager, Allied Health Community is accountable for program implementation, operationalization, management, and ongoing evaluation of Allied Health Community programs.
